Comics Corner
Since going to my LCS is now a regular Friday thing, why not highlight it here? My pull file consists of every book in Skybound’s Energon Universe, which is made up of VOID RIVALS, TRANSFORMERS, and various G.I. Joe characters. They have enough series in motion that week there’s a new book coming out. This week it was Void Rivals #8.
This wasn’t a long issue, and it moved the story probably the least compared to the other issues, but it paid off the arrival of a new villain that was teased in #7. I’ve got to find time to do an Energon video on the channel to explain all of these.
This week also saw the launch of GHOST MACHINE from Image comics, which is its own universe and continuity. For the next six months they have three series going, called Geiger, Redcoat, and Rook Exodus. I sampled these titles in a recent video and I had no interest in Geiger, but the other two caught my attention and I bought them this week.
Haven’t read Redcoat yet but Rook Exodus was really, really impressive. Full video coming soon.
